THE TALIBAN ATTACKED AFGHANISTAN GOVERNMENT COMPOUND IN GHAZNI PROVINCE ON THURSDAY, KILLING FIFTEEN PEOPLE.

It was reported that on Thursday, the Taliban attacked the Afghan government compound, killing fifteen people. According to the report, the attack occurred in the Khuja Omari district (Ghazni province) and three local officials, police officers and government officials were among those killed. The Ghazni province is largely under the Taliban control and the terrorist group have claimed responsibility for the attack. May the souls of the dead rest in peace.
